Elvin T.
Tatum
June 11, 1937 – November 20, 2015
Elvin T. Tatum, 78 of Fayetteville passed away on Friday, November 20, 2015 in Cape Fear Valley Medical Center. He was born on June 11, 1937 in Cumberland County to the late Mary Louise Nordan and Elvin Lee Tatum. Elvin was a retired newspaper carrier with the Fayetteville Observer after 39 years. He was a retired employee from Merita Bakery after 14 years. Elvin was a former member of Comfort Presbyterian Church where he served as pianist. He was preceded in death by his sisters Phyllis Singletary and Lundie Tatum. Funeral services will be held on Monday, November 23, 2015 at 2:00 p.m. in Jernigan-Warren Chapel with the Reverends Paula and Scot McCosh, officiating. Burial will follow in Lafayette Memorial Park on Ramsey St. The family will receive friends at the funeral home on Monday, November 23, 2015 from 1:00 p.m. until 2:00 p.m.
He is survived by his beloved wife of 60 years, Dorothy Trogdon Tatum of the home; sons, Elvin T. Tatum, Jr. and wife Deborah of Raeford; James Tatum of Fayetteville; daughters, Teresa Tatum of Fayetteville; Faith Tuttle and husband Robert of Stedman; grandchildren, Rebecca Tatum, Trey Tatum, Christopher Tuttle, Michael Tuttle and James Napier and great-grandchildren, Miranda Napier and Savannah Allen.
